1. What is the Average Output Voltage for Continuous Load Current?

The Average Output Voltage for Continuous Load Current in a 3-phase half converter is the DC voltage output averaged over one complete cycle when the load current is continuous. It is a key parameter in power electronics and AC-DC conversion systems.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the formula:

\[ V_{avg(3Φ-half)} = \frac{3 \times \sqrt{3} \times V_{in(3Φ-half)i} \times \cos(\alpha_{d(3Φ-half)})}{2 \times \pi} \]

Where:

Explanation: The formula calculates the average DC output voltage based on the peak input voltage and the delay angle (firing angle) of the thyristors in the converter circuit.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What is a 3-phase half converter?
A: A 3-phase half converter is a type of controlled rectifier that converts 3-phase AC power to DC power using thyristors, typically with a freewheeling diode for continuous load current.

Q2: What is the delay angle in a converter circuit?
A: The delay angle (or firing angle) is the phase angle at which the thyristor is triggered to start conducting, measured from the zero-crossing point of the AC voltage waveform.

Q3: How does the delay angle affect the output voltage?
A: As the delay angle increases, the output voltage decreases due to the cosine relationship in the formula. At 0° delay, maximum voltage is obtained.

Q4: What is continuous load current?
A: Continuous load current means the current never drops to zero during the operation, which is achieved with sufficiently inductive loads or proper circuit design.

Q5: What are typical applications of 3-phase half converters?
A: These converters are used in industrial applications such as DC motor drives, battery charging systems, and power supplies where controlled DC voltage is required.
